Week7 Performance Testing 2

This week I used performance flame graph at the suggestion of my mentor Christian to find out where my patch affected the performance of cat-file --batch. oid_object_info_extended() takes the largest proportion of time, it accounts for 90.28% and 41.60% in cat-file --batch and cat-file --batch-check respectively. Part of the reason is that oid_object_info_extended() is called twice in get_object() with my patch. I tried to revise its logic (WIP), the performance is improved when not using --textconv and --filters.

Ævar Arnfjörð Bjarmason gave me a good suggestion on performance regression: When we use the default format of git cat-file --batch-check or git cat-file --batch, we can directly print the meta-data of the object without going through the logic of ref-filter; When we use other format, use the logic in ref-filter.

In addition, Ævar Arnfjörð Bjarmason also suggests adding a performance test for git cat-file --batch, this can help us analyze and compare performance changes later.
